#68ebb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68ebb8 is composed of 40.8% red, 92.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 156.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 66.5%. #68ebb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00d771.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#68ebb8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68ebb8 has RGB values of R:104, G:235,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 6876088.

Shades and Tints of #68ebb8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68ebb8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3b0ab is the less saturated color, while #54ffbc is the most saturated one.
